This formula can be applied to any temperature reading in Celsius. By multiplying the temperature by 9, dividing the result by 5, and then adding 32, you will obtain the equivalent temperature in Fahrenheit.

Therefore, 20 degrees Celsius is equivalent to 68 degrees Fahrenheit.
To convert 20 degrees Celsius into Fahrenheit, you can use the following simple formula:

Reality: While both scales measure temperature, they have different scales and units. Celsius is the standard unit in most countries, while Fahrenheit is primarily used in the US.

The conversion formula is highly accurate, with minimal rounding errors when performed manually or using a calculator. However, keep in mind that temperature readings can vary slightly depending on the location and method of measurement.
